Patrick Yantz

Patrick Yantz is the vice president of data center solutions at CommScope. Patrick has a passion for delivering the most efficient, cost effective, and holistic data center solutions to customers around the world, by leading in the development and implementation of innovations that change the way infrastructure is designed, manufactured, delivered, and supported. Previously he was Chief Innovation Officer at Saivertech Corp and Principal Member of the Saiver Modular Data Center program, where he designed and delivered the world's most efficient data centers around the globe. Prior to that, he was responsible for the Vision, Strategy, and Scaling of the SGI Container and Modular Data Center business. Past experience includes Enterprise level Data Center Architecture, Design Management, Data Center Research, Engineering, Systems Architecture, Global Operations, Hosting Services, Business, Program, People, and Project Management. He started as owner of a custom computer consulting service in the Pacific Northwest then developed a strong foundation in the Valley while participating in the data center evolution as a server system, network, and sales engineer in the hosting services space. Past roles include Architecting Microsoft’s Generation 4 Enterprise Modular Data Centers and coordinating with and managing Global, Regional, and local Architecture, Engineering, and Construction firms. In addition he led engineers to design and deliver low cost, low PUE, and operationally superior modular data centers. He was responsible for architecting and engineering individual globally deployable modular data center systems. He owned the delivery and piloted Microsoft's first outdoor Modular Server System (ITPAC) capable of being independently deployed globally, requiring no chilled water, with outside air as the primary means of cooling. He regularly speaks to industry leaders and Officers on the subjects of Enterprise Operational Management, Data Centers, Modular Data center Design, Infrastructure, and Paradigm shifting Technologies.
